What To Expect
Join our Chef’s Table at Kulaniapia Falls for an exclusive evening of lovely local-style food and conversation in a casual and gorgeous setting. This will not be a restaurant style experience: we are a small and exclusive local-style venue that sources ingredients daily.
Our chefs create each evening’s menu based on what is fresh, local, and in season. Our goal is to present at least 80% Hawaiian ingredients to showcase the bounty and beauty of our islands.
Our philosophy is to provide an immersive but unpretentious dining experience where guests learn about local food and culture while enjoying the camaraderie of fellow guests and the awesome natural beauty of Kulaniapia Falls. Chefs will explain the sources of local ingredients, share information about the history of Hawaiian food cultures, and present a series of tasting-menu style dishes to delight all of your senses.
